## Local Setup — Deep-Link Routing

Support folks: to trace why a Quellith mobile deep link lands on the wrong screen, run the router sandbox with `make linkdebug`, paste the customer's link, and inspect the resolved route table output. Route mappings are stored in the links database, not in the app bundle. Connect the sandbox using the connection string below.

primary connection of tadup-tagep = mongodb://fendor_svc:6hZCOAA@db-14a7.plorvaworks.test:5432/giliel

As part of our quarterly credential hygiene cycle, we are rotating the API key used by the LanternSearch autocomplete index. You may have noticed elevated latency on suggestion queries this week; the rotation is unrelated, but we are taking the opportunity to retire the old credential early. The previous key will be revoked on Friday at 17:00. All consumers of the index, including the batch reranker, must switch over before then. The replacement key is provided below for your review.

gateway credential: kto3_qfe

## Further reading

The Hollowfen ORM shim exists only to bridge the legacy Quernstone data layer to the new repository interfaces. Avoid adding features to it; the goal is deletion. Migration order, deprecated query patterns, and the strangler strategy are documented for maintainers. The full refactoring roadmap lives on the internal page here.

wiki page, tahaf-tajog: https://jira.ordindyn.corp/pipeline